Rainfall totals in central Nigeria varies from 1,100 mm (43.3 in) in the lowlands of the river Niger Benue trough to over 2,000 mm (78.7 in) along the south western escarpment of the Jos Plateau. Potiskum, Yobe State in the northeast of Nigeria recorded Nigeria’s lowest ever temperature of 2.8 °C (37.0 °F). The single dry season experienced in this climate, the tropical savanna climate in central Nigeria beginning from December to March, is hot and dry with the Harmattan wind, a continental tropical (CT) airmass laden with dust from the Sahara Desert prevailing throughout this period. Nigeria's most expansive topographical region is that of the valleys of the Niger and Benue River valleys (which merge into each other and form a "y" shaped confluence at Lokoja).
